Short Run: 'Smarter health: Episode II'


Listen Later

There is a sophisticated computer model that can estimate a patient's chance of dying in the next year. It's being used at a Stanford hospital to encourage important end of life care conversations and decisions.

But would you want to know if an algorithm predicted when you might die?

Ethics and AI. It's episode II of On Point's special series Smarter health.
